Release Date: 2009-10-26
⭐ 0.0
A Power Rangers and Evangelion spoof by the Duncan Brothers and Brenan Campbell.
Stephan Stefanopoulos
Steven Stefanopoulos
Garth Blackburn
Commander Stryker
Orange
Phoenix Stryker